One of the biggest, and most surprising, bits of news that I heard recently is that Book 4 of the Legend of Korra will be debuting October 3, 2014. After the incredible finale of Book 3, I'm honestly excited about this final chapter of the series. And, if I'm honest, I am also sad that it is coming to an end.

I can only hope in a few years that we get another Avatar series, one that has all the heart and charm of Avatar: The Last Airbender & The Legend of Korra. If not that, I would be more than welcome a comic book series. :)

The first arch of Savage Hulk, written and illustrated by legendary Alan Davis, came to an end this week. It was a truly incredible climax! A very entertaining series! I'm looking forward to future story arches of this series.
